
Summary
Rhea - dark, intense and brilliant - and her golden, voluptuous sister Amber are not alike, but they are bound tighter than most: by love, by the loss of their father, and by the man who stands between them. Lewis is Amber’s husband and the ferociously driven director of the biotech lab where Rhea is a rising star.

Critics Review
Absorbing, authoritative, exciting, aesthetically beautiful … Breathing on Glass is unlike anything else I’ve ever read … The triumph of the novel is that these immensely ambitious and complex intellectual themes are integrated and carried through in a narrative that is aesthetically rich and beautiful and deep – Tessa Hadley, author of The London Train
In her gripping tale of laboratories and latex gloves, scientific one-upmanship and sibling rivalry, Jennifer Cryer puts the sex into medical research - and gives the classic love triangle a thrillingly modern twist … A spirited novel’s wry look at the lengths scientist will go to achieve glory. But a different level of deception is also examined in the relationship between Rhea and Amber – Genevieve Fox * Daily Mail *
Cryer’s sensual precision works best when this part thriller, part domestic tangle deals with science … . The questions raised about the limits of scientific ambition are timely – Catherine Taylor * Guardian *
Jennifer Cryer
Jennifer Cryer was born and grew up in a Northumbrian mining village. Married, she now lives in South Wales. After studying Biochemistry and working in hospital, university and industrial laboratories, she also completed a PhD in creative writing and has combined these two interests in her first novel.
